Advances in Recycling Technologies


As we step into 2024, the landscape of recycling technologies is undergoing a transformative evolution, marking a pivotal chapter in our pursuit of a greener, more sustainable future. The rising urgency to address environmental challenges and resource scarcity is driving innovation at an unprecedented pace. This year promises significant advancements that not only enhance the efficiency of recycling processes but also expand their scope to encompass a wider array of materials.


One of the key trends shaping the recycling industry is the adoption of artificial intelligence and machine learning. These technologies are revolutionizing sorting processes by improving accuracy and speed. Advanced optical sensors and AI algorithms can now identify and separate materials with remarkable precision, reducing contamination rates and ensuring higher-quality recyclables. This development not only increases the profitability of recycling operations but also reduces waste sent to landfills.


Another exciting advancement is in chemical recycling technologies. Unlike traditional mechanical recycling, which often degrades material quality over time, chemical recycling breaks down plastics into their original monomers or other usable chemicals. This process allows for infinite recyclability without loss in performance, addressing long-standing issues related to plastic waste. As research progresses, chemical recycling is expected to become more energy-efficient and commercially viable.


Biological recycling methods are also gaining traction as part of this green revolution. Researchers are exploring enzymes capable of breaking down complex polymers like PET plastics at ambient temperatures, offering an environmentally friendly alternative to conventional practices. Such innovations hold promise for tackling hard-to-recycle materials while minimizing carbon footprints.

Impact of Legislation and Policy Changes


The year 2024 marks a pivotal moment in the evolving landscape of recycling, where legislation and policy changes are poised to significantly influence recycling trends. As nations grapple with the mounting challenges of waste management and environmental sustainability, legislative measures have emerged as powerful tools for driving positive change. Understanding these shifts is crucial for anyone interested in fostering a greener future.


In recent years, there has been an increasing recognition of the critical role that governments play in shaping sustainable practices. This has led to the introduction of more stringent regulations aimed at reducing waste and promoting recycling at both national and international levels. In 2024, we expect to see a continuation of this trend, with policymakers enacting laws designed to enhance recycling rates and minimize landfill use.


One significant area of focus is the reduction of single-use plastics. Many countries are implementing bans or heavy taxes on plastic products that are not biodegradable or recyclable. These legislative actions are expected to drive innovation in packaging and product design, encouraging companies to adopt alternative materials that have lower environmental impacts. As consumers increasingly demand eco-friendly options, businesses will be incentivized to align their practices with these new standards.


Moreover, extended producer responsibility (EPR) schemes are gaining traction globally. EPR policies hold manufacturers accountable for the entire lifecycle of their products, including disposal and recycling processes. By placing the onus on producers rather than consumers or municipalities, these policies aim to create a circular economy where resources are reused continuously rather than discarded after a single use. In 2024, we anticipate broader adoption of EPR frameworks across various sectors such as electronics, textiles, and packaging.


At the same time, advancements in technology are playing an integral role in transforming how waste is managed. Digital platforms that track waste streams from source to processing facilities can provide valuable data insights that inform more efficient recycling strategies. Legislation supporting technological integration ensures transparency and efficiency within recycling systems while minimizing contamination—a common barrier to effective recycling.


International cooperation also remains vital in advancing global recycling efforts. Treaties like the Basel Convention highlight the importance of cross-border collaboration in managing hazardous wastes responsibly. In 2024, enhanced international dialogue may lead to more standardized global regulations that prevent waste dumping in less developed nations while promoting equitable access to advanced recycling technologies.

Challenges and Opportunities for the Recycling Industry


As we stand on the brink of 2024, the recycling industry faces a complex landscape that presents both formidable challenges and promising opportunities. The global push towards sustainability has never been stronger, yet the path to a greener future is fraught with obstacles that require innovative solutions and collaborative efforts.


One of the primary challenges confronting the recycling industry is the issue of contamination. Despite increased awareness about recycling practices, improper sorting remains a significant hurdle. Contaminated materials can render entire batches of recyclables unusable, leading to increased costs and inefficiencies. To combat this, there is a growing need for improved public education campaigns and clearer labeling on packaging to guide consumers in proper recycling practices.


Moreover, advancements in technology present both an opportunity and a challenge for the industry. On one hand, new technologies have the potential to revolutionize materials recovery facilities by enhancing sorting precision through artificial intelligence and robotics. These advancements could significantly reduce contamination rates and improve overall efficiency. However, integrating such technologies requires substantial investment, which may be prohibitive for smaller operations.


The global market for recycled materials also poses significant challenges. Fluctuations in demand and pricing can create instability within the industry. For instance, when prices for virgin materials drop, recycled alternatives become less economically viable. To address this, there is an increasing call for policies that mandate or incentivize the use of recycled content in manufacturing processes.


On a more positive note, there are ample opportunities arising from heightened consumer consciousness about environmental issues. As more people demand sustainable products and packaging solutions, companies are being pressured to adopt circular economy principles. This shift not only drives innovation within product design but also encourages businesses to establish closed-loop supply chains that prioritize recyclability.


Furthermore, legislative changes across various regions are setting ambitious targets for waste reduction and recycling rates. Governments worldwide are increasingly recognizing their role in fostering sustainable environments through supportive policies and infrastructure investment. Such initiatives can provide a fertile ground for growth within the recycling sector by creating stable markets for recycled goods.
